To convey these tax ideas to life, consider the real-world instance of a recent lottery winner. Let’s say that Jane wins $500,000 from her state lottery. Initially, 24% or $120,000 shall be withheld for federal taxes, leaving her with $380,000. If Jane lives in a state with a 5% tax rate, a further $25,000 will be withheld, bringing her total deductions to $145,000. After taxes, her take-home whole is now $355,000. It’s vital to acknowledge that whereas winning a big sum can be extremely thrilling, the fact is that you will typically solely receive a fraction of that amount due to taxes. This example serves to spotlight the importance of understanding the tax implications of lottery winnings and the way they will probably impact your life.

Taxes are an unavoidable reality when discussing [Lotto Winning Probability](https://gillotblog.com/%eb%a1%9c%eb%98%90-%eb%b6%84%ec%84%9d%ec%9d%98-%ec%83%88%eb%a1%9c%ec%9a%b4-%ec%a7%80%ed%8f%89-%ed%94%84%eb%a6%ac%eb%98%90%ec%99%80-%ed%95%a8%ea%bb%98%ed%95%98%ec%84%b8%ec%9a%94/) payout schedules. In the United States, lottery winnings are taxed as odd income, which means they can be subjected to federal, state, and probably native taxes. The precise tax fee can differ significantly depending on the winner's tax bracket and the state by which the ticket is purchased. For occasion, states like Florida and Texas do not impose a state income tax, which can influence many to buy tickets in these states. Additionally, winners choosing the lump-sum possibility might face a larger tax burden within the 12 months they win, as opposed to those who choose the annuity choice, who may benefit from a decrease common tax bracket over time. Understanding the tax implications can drastically have an result on your financial planning after winning.
